Guiding the Enterprise: From the CEO's Seat

A CEO's role is multifaceted and demanding. They are responsible for steering the company's direction, cultivating a positive company culture, and implementing strategic initiatives. Effective leadership from the top is crucial for an organization's success. CEOs must inspire their teams to achieve ambitious objectives, while also overcoming complex challenges and responding to a constantly changing environment.

  • A key aspect of leading from the top is communication. CEOs must clearly share their vision to employees at all levels, creating a sense of alignment.
  • Trusting employees is another crucial element. CEOs who champion employee autonomy often see greater engagement.
  • Finally, a CEO must be a bold leader, able to make difficult decisions in the best interests of the company.
